I was going to stay away from this one, but Earthdog your way behind the times on this one. Should Women be drafted into the military? Yes, if their country has a draft. I am a Desert Storm Veteran and through out my military career I've met both men and women I'd NOT want to share a foxhole with. More men than women I might add. I have found most of the women in the military, have every bit of the courage any man has. Stamina is another thing.
It is true that most women do not have the upper body strength to function in a combat role. Notice I said "most". But if a woman can
pass the same PT (Physical Training) test that a man can, then they should be allowed in combat.

Calab, sex has nothing to do with how good a sniper is. It has everything to do with dexitarty and hand eye coordination. I can take just about anyone and train them to be a great marksman, if they have the will. It's mostly muscle memory. I taught marksmanship in the Army Reserve for the last five years of my career. Given a weekend we, typically averaged 94% qualification for a unit we helped.
It didn't matter if they were men or women.
